ERASMUS programmeerasmuslogo

The ERASMUS programme is the European Commission's flagship educational mobility programme for Higher Education students, teachers and institutions, and forms part of the EU Lifelong Learning Programme (2007-2013). It offers a framework and finances to encourage student and staff mobility for work and study, and promotes trans-national co-operation projects among universities across Europe.

It broadly consists of two major strands:

  • Student mobility (including Study placement, Work placements and Intensive Programmes), and
  • Staff Mobility (Teaching and Training)

We currently have nearly 200 student and staff agreements with over 100 EU institutions in 20 European countries.

Student and staff mobility via the ERASMUS programme is administered by the Erasmus & Study Abroad team, part of the Reading International Office.
